### Decreasing Costs Drive Solar Adoption
Over the past decade, the cost of solar energy panels has dropped dramatically, making solar power an attractive option for residential, commercial, and industrial users. Economies of scale, technological improvements, and streamlined production processes have all contributed to this reduction. Today, the average cost per watt of solar panels is a fraction of what it was ten years ago, allowing more users to invest in renewable energy systems without prohibitive upfront expenses.
Lower costs also facilitate the implementation of solar power in developing countries, where electricity infrastructure is often insufficient or unreliable. Many regions face persistent energy shortages, and traditional power grids are unable to meet increasing demands. Solar energy panels provide a practical alternative, offering decentralized power generation and the opportunity to electrify rural and remote areas.

### The Role of Energy Storage in Renewable Integration
One of the main challenges with solar energy has traditionally been its intermittent nature; the sun doesn’t shine all the time. This intermittency requires effective energy storage solutions to ensure a steady power supply. BR Solar’s involvement in energy storage systems allows customers to maximize the benefits of solar panels by storing surplus energy generated during the day for wide-ranging use.
Lithium batteries, in particular, have gained prominence due to their high energy density, longer life cycle, and fast charging capabilities. Gelled batteries also offer a maintenance-free, durable option ideal for various solar applications. Paired with high-quality inverters that convert direct current (DC) from solar panels and batteries into usable alternating current (AC), these components form a comprehensive system that meets diverse energy needs.
